The Leica Dmi8 is a fully motorized, multi-modal inverted epifluorescent microscope. The system offers various transmitted light illumination techniques (brightfield, phase contrast, differential interference contrast, cross polarisers), epifluorescence, 2 discrete cameras, shading correction, full environmental control for Live Cell Imaging. The microscope is equipped with filters for DAPI, FITC, Rhod, Y5 and related fluorochromes, as well as with a multi-filter for FRET applications (CFP/YFP) and Calcium imaging (Fura2 @340/380nm). Applications include multi-colour epi-fluorescent imaging, multi-colour 3D imaging, 4D imaging (x, y, z, and time), live cell imaging, steady state Förster/fluorescence resonance energy transfer (FRET) (CFP/YFP), calcium imaging with FURA-2.
